About Benin City Time Zone

Benin City uses the Africa/Lagos IANA time zone, which is the standard time zone for most of Nigeria. Its offset is UTC+1 all year, meaning local time in Benin City is always one hour 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. This fixed offset makes scheduling simpler than in countries that switch clocks seasonally.

Benin City does not observe daylight saving time (DST), and Nigeria does not currently change clocks at any point in the year. That means the city stays on West Africa Time (WAT) throughout January, June, and December alike. For international coordination, this is especially helpful because the only changes users usually need to track come from other countries such as the United Kingdom or the United States when they enter or leave DST.

Benin City is the capital of Edo State in southern Nigeria, and it shares the same time as Lagos, Abuja, Port Harcourt, and Kano. It is also aligned with several neighboring West and Central African areas that use UTC+1, while being 1 hour ahead of Ghana (UTC+0) and often 1 hour ahead of the UK in winter but the same as the UK in summer when Britain moves to British Summer Time. This matters for trade, customer support, aviation planning, and remote work across West Africa and Europe.

Time Differences from Benin City

Benin City is in UTC+1, but the exact time difference with other cities can change during the year because some countries observe daylight saving time while Nigeria does not. That seasonal shift is especially important when scheduling recurring calls with North America, Europe, and Australia.

  • New York: Benin City is usually 6 hours ahead of New York during US Eastern Standard Time and 5 hours ahead during US Eastern Daylight Time. When it is 9:00 AM in Benin City, it is 3:00 AM in New York in winter or 4:00 AM in New York in summer, so morning calls from Nigeria are often too early for the US East Coast.
  • London: Benin City is 1 hour ahead of London during UK winter, but the same time as London during British Summer Time. When it is 9:00 AM in Benin City, it is 8:00 AM in London in winter and 9:00 AM in London in summer, which makes UK-Nigeria business coordination relatively easy.
  • Tokyo: Benin City is 8 hours behind Tokyo all year because Japan does not observe DST and remains on UTC+9. When it is 9:00 AM in Benin City, it is 5:00 PM in Tokyo, which can work for same-day handoffs between Nigerian daytime teams and Japanese late-afternoon teams.
  • Sydney: Benin City is typically 9 hours behind Sydney during Australian standard time and 10 hours behind during Australian daylight saving time in New South Wales. When it is 9:00 AM in Benin City, it is usually 6:00 PM in Sydney or 7:00 PM during Sydney DST, so overlap tends to fall between Nigerian mornings and Australian evenings.
  • Dubai: Benin City is 3 hours behind Dubai year-round because Dubai stays on UTC+4 with no DST. When it is 9:00 AM in Benin City, it is 12:00 PM in Dubai, making late-morning Nigeria time a practical window for trade, shipping, and aviation-related communication with the UAE.

For real scheduling, the most convenient overlap is often Benin City afternoon with Europe morning-to-midday, or Benin City morning with Dubai midday. Calls with New York usually work better in the late afternoon or evening in Benin City, while Tokyo and Sydney often require either early Nigerian mornings or later Nigerian business-day compromises.

Frequently Asked Questions

What time zone is Benin City in?

Benin City is in the Africa/Lagos time zone, which is the standard IANA time zone used across Nigeria. The city follows West Africa Time (WAT) with a fixed offset of UTC+1 throughout the year.

Does Benin City observe daylight saving time?

No, Benin City does not observe daylight saving time, and Nigeria does not currently change clocks seasonally. This means the local time in Benin City stays on UTC+1 in every month, so any seasonal time difference changes usually come from countries like the US or UK instead.

What is the time difference between Benin City and New York?

The time difference depends on whether New York is on standard time or daylight saving time. Benin City is 6 hours ahead of New York during US winter and 5 hours ahead during US summer, so a 2 PM meeting in Benin City would be 8 AM in New York in winter or 9 AM in New York in summer.

What is the best time to call Benin City from the US or UK?

From the UK, late morning to mid-afternoon is usually the easiest because Benin City is only 0 to 1 hour ahead depending on the season. From the US East Coast, the best time is often 8 AM to 11 AM New York time, which corresponds to roughly 1 PM to 4 PM in Benin City during US daylight saving time and 2 PM to 5 PM during US standard time.

What is the UTC offset for Benin City?

Benin City uses a fixed UTC+1 offset all year. Because there is no daylight saving time in Nigeria, the UTC offset does not switch to another value in summer or winter.

What currency does Benin City use?

Benin City uses the Nigerian naira (NGN), the official currency of Nigeria. If you are booking accommodation, paying local vendors, or budgeting for transport in Edo State, prices will normally be quoted in naira rather than in foreign currency.

Is Benin City the same time as Lagos?

Yes, Benin City and Lagos are on the same time zone: Africa/Lagos (UTC+1). There is no domestic time difference between the two cities, so business calls, transport schedules, and event planning can be coordinated without any clock adjustment.
